Kevin - Re: "The cacheless Pentium II is probably cheaper to produce (smaller die size) and it gives Intel the advantage of transitioning the market to its proprietary Slot architecture. "

The rumor is that the L2 cache will be removed from the SEC card - no change will be made to the Pentium II die itself - including its 32K Byte L1 cache.

As for transitioning to the Slot 1 architecture, this is probably the case.

If Intel can offer comparable performance, they will be able to command a premium in pricing vis-a-vis AMD and Cyrix competitive products - and still get a lot of business.

Just look at AMD's and Cyrix's financial statements - they are testaments to Intel's success.
